乳业废水脱磷效率提升实践  

Practice of Improving Dephosphorization Efficiency of Dairy Wastewater

摘  要:乳业废水通常需要化学脱磷才能满足总磷排放的要求。在乳业实际运行过程中存在着污泥产生量大,脱磷药剂耗量高,排水总磷不稳定等问题。通过将需要脱磷的污泥输入好氧系统进行循环,具有操作简单、药剂消耗下降、降低污泥量、排水总磷稳定、不影响好氧系统运行等优点,使得运行费用及排放稳定性得到显著促进和提升,值得推广。Dairy wastewater usually needs chemical dephosphorization to meet the requirements of total phosphorus discharge. In the actual operation process,there are problems such as large sludge production,high consumption of dephosphorization agent and unstable total phosphorus in drainage. By circulating the dephosphorized sludge into the aerobic system,it has the advantages of simple operation,reduced reagent consumption,reduced sludge volume,stable total phosphorus drainage,and no impact on the operation of the aerobic system. The operation cost and discharge stability have been significantly promoted and improved,which is worth promoting.
